David M. Webster

Corporate Associate at Adler Pollock & Sheehan P.C.

David M. Webster currently serves as a Corporate Associate at Adler Pollock & Sheehan P.C. since February 2022. Prior experience includes working as a waiter at Coast Guard House from March 2015 to February 2022, and holding several legal internships and positions, including Tax Clinic Intern at Quinnipiac University School of Law and Research Assistant at the Rhode Island Department of Health. David also gained legal experience as a Law Clerk for Judge Brian P. Stern at the Rhode Island Superior Court. Earlier professional experience includes serving as Kitchen Supervisor at Greggs Restaurants and Taverns from January 2012 to April 2016. David holds a Juris Doctorate from Quinnipiac University (2020) and a Bachelor's degree in Political Science/Economics from the University of Rhode Island (2017).

Adler Pollock & Sheehan P.C.

Adler Pollock & Sheehan P.C. is a business-oriented, full-service law firm committed to providing clients with the highest levels of legal service through a wide variety of practice areas in our Providence, Rhode Island; Newport, Rhode Island; Boston, Massachusetts; and Manchester, New Hampshire offices. We are proud of a demonstrated record of achievement, sustained by a genuine and deep-rooted commitment to the ideals of the legal profession. The core of the AP&S approach is a focus on the client which is evident in the personal partner-level attention each client receives. We pride ourselves on always striving to increase efficiencies and effectiveness, always considering the view through the client's lens---from fair and innovative billing practices and round-the-clock access to the intelligent application of the latest technology for efficient management of complex legal issues. Since the founding of the firm in 1960, AP&S has become one of the region's most respected and successful business law practices with more than 60 lawyers in Providence, Boston and New Hampshire. AP&S continues to grow through planned, sustained efforts reflecting a heightened sensitivity and overriding obligation to the diverse needs of business and industry leaders.
